内容
In the last 2 centuries, agriculture has been an outstanding successstory. Agriculture has fed population with a variety of products at fallingprices, even as it has released a number of workers to the rest of theeconomy. This book explains how these feats were accomplished. It coversvarious factors that have affected agricultural performance.
